A person is running over a mountainous terrain, the equation of the surface of the terrain is given by f = sin(2x)+3 cos (6лy). The runner is travelling at a velocity of 3t² in the x-direction and 2t in the y-direction, where t denotes the time elapsed. Find the rate of change of f with respect to t at the instant t = 4. Assume that at t = 0, both x and y are 0.
